Mr. Franklin D. Cantrell age 74 of jasper died Thursday April 18,2019.
Mr. Cantrell was born February 4,1945, in Cherokee County the son of the late Herbert Mitchell and Lillian Cearly Cantrell, he was a veteran serving with the US Navy and worked in construction. His parents and son Jerry Lee Cantrell preceded him in death.
Survivors include: daughters and son-in-laws; Tina and Guy Childers, Jasper, Debbie and Shane Hudson, Jasper, sons and daughters-in-law; Terry and Terry Cantrell, Pigeon Forge,TN,Frankie and Penny Cantrell, Jasper, and Misty Henson, Dahlonega, 9 grandchildren; Josh, Justin, Christi, Andrea, MaKalya, T.J., J.J., Austin, and Casey, 9 great-grandchildren, Camron, Kaliana, Euanee, Addison, Tayte, Brantley and Phoenix.
Funeral services will be held Saturday at 4:00 pm from the chapel of Bernhardt Funeral Home with Pastor Ken Anderson officiating. Interment will be in the Ball Ground City cemetery.
The family will meet with friends Saturday from noon until 4:00 pm at the funeral home.
